 -- LEARNING OUTCOMES OF THE COURSE UNIT
Know and define the basic concepts related to instructional technology.
Classify instructional objectives.
Make planning of the teaching situation.
Evaluate the various physics teaching materials.
Where necessary, select the appropriate physics teaching materials and uses.
Know the design elements, visual materials related to design and design principles.
Develop various physics teaching materials through technology teaching.
Know the purpose of the use of computers in physics education.
Knows how to do and in what ways of distance education.
Evaluate various aspects of distance education.

 --COURSE CONTENT
1. Week  Basic Concepts Related to Instructional Technology: What is Technology? What is Instructional Technology?
2. Week  Instructional Analysis: Classification of the Objectives, Why is Setting Goals important? How to Write Objectives?
3. Week  Planning Instructional Conditions: Check the Activities of Planning, Content Presentation, Planning, Planning Exercises, Feedback Planning, Evaluation
4. Week  Selection of the Various Physics Teaching Tools, Evaluation and Effective Use
5. Week  Visual Materials Design: Design Elements, Design Principles Development of Physics Teaching Materials Through Instructional Technologies
6. Week  Using Computers in Education: Teaching as a means of computers, the computers as a communication tool, computers as a means of production
7. Week  Distance Education
